Gilroy More than 200 scientists associated with the Walther Cancer Institute will gather at the University of Notre Dames McKenna Hall Aug. 5-7 for their annual scientific retreat.p. Hosted by the Universitys Walther Cancer Research Center, the event will offer Walther researchers an opportunity to share their research, disseminate their findings, and foster interactions among Walther researchers. The program includes a plenary lecture, representative lectures from each Walther center on their current research, and poster sessions to enable Walther researchers to present their latest findings. In addition, postdoctoral fellows and graduate students will participate in an abstract competition.p. The Walther Cancer Institute is an Indianapolis-based nonprofit medical research organization that employs leading biomedical and behavioral scientists at various Midwestern universities to vigorously extend the frontiers of cancer research.p. Notre Dames Walther Cancer Research Center, established in 1994, is collaboration between the University and the Walther Cancer Institute. It includes activities in the Departments of Chemistry and Biochemistry, Biological Sciences and Preprofessional Studies.p. _Contact: Rudolph M.
